  • imageMelly Mel:
    I have the Bissel Pet and I no longer love it. In the beginning it worked well but now it is losing power, and we have only had it one year. We have one dog. I think the only vacuum I have heard good things about is the Dyson Animal. It is  expensive though but we may bite the bullet and get one soon.

    I would recommend cleaning out all the tubing. I thought my Bissel Pet had finally bit the dust too (4 years and 4 cats the entire time...) so I asked Santa (aka Mom and Dad) to bring me a for Christmas and I got another Bissel Pet. My dad took the original home to take a look at it. He found tons of small hair clogs that contributed to it losing suction. Now I have one Bissel Pet vacuum downstairs and another upstairs.

    Why I love the Bissel Pet:

    1) The price

    2) Efficient. Before this vacuum I could not sit on the floor at all, period. Now I can lay on the floor and roll around with LO and not be sneezing, watery eyes, congested within seconds. More like 30 minutes now and thats if I haven't vacuumed in a couple of days.

    3) Filters are cheap and the two filters come packaged together. Available at Walmart

    4) Easy to empty, easy to use and cart around, easy to use attachments.
